Activating Adaptive Cruise Control (ACC)

You can only activate ACC if the vehicle speed is above 20 mph (32 km/h).

When the system is turned on and in the READY state, the Electronic Vehicle Information Center (EVIC) displays “Adaptive Cruise Ready.” When the system is OFF, the EVIC displays “Adaptive Cruise Control Off.”

NOTE: You cannot enable ACC under the following conditions:

• When in Four-Wheel Drive Low.

• When you apply the brakes.

• When the parking brake is set.

• When the automatic transmission is in PARK, REVERSE or NEUTRAL.

• When pushing the RES + button without a previously set speed in memory.
